Output 2ec6cbf1aec2fff42935869c108be8b59cd03121f7663276f39dbcf11775e65c:0

value
2836585
script pubkey
OP_0 OP_PUSHBYTES_20 df709550848e7d2e39fa1452678241e16a882906
address
bc1qmacf25yy3e7juw06z3fx0qjpu94gs2gxtxplt5
transaction
2ec6cbf1aec2fff42935869c108be8b59cd03121f7663276f39dbcf11775e65c
confirmations
2429
spent
true